Negative Space Coloring


Happy Monday, Sweet 'n Sassy friends! 
It's Ceal here to share a card with you using a technique I have been wanting to try since I seen Jennifer McGuire use it. The technique is called negative space coloring and there are different ways you can do this technique using different coloring mediums. For my card I masked off the image and used some watercolors but you can also use Copic markers or Distress inks. 
I used the Precious Poppies set which was perfect for this technique. Our Flower Blocks sets would also make a gorgeous card using this technique.
The greeting is from the Keep in Touch, Too set.
